ECOS® and Green For All Join Forces to Fight for Underserved Communities Impacted by COVID-19 Outbreak

[Apr. 8, 2020] –Cypress, Calif. – Green-cleaning pioneer ECOS®, the maker of safer, plant-powered laundry detergents and household cleaning products, is partnering with Green For All, a program of the non-profit group Dream Corps founded by civil rights activist Van Jones, to help vulnerable communities facing imminent and long-term impacts from the COVID-19 pandemic. 

As ECOS ramps up its production of hypoallergenic hand soap and other urgently needed cleaning products to meet unprecedented global demand, it is committed to ensuring that the needs of all communities, especially those most vulnerable economically, are met during this health crisis.

Green For All is a national program that is working to build an inclusive green economy strong enough to lift people out of poverty. Green For All works at the intersection of the environmental, economic justice, and racial justice movements to advance solutions to pollution that uplift low-income families and communities of color. 

The COVID-19 outbreak poses additional challenges to these communities, which are impacted first and worst by crisis, climate change, income inequality, and pollution. ECOS and Green For All are working with lawmakers to ensure those who are impacted most by the COVID-19 outbreak and ensuing economic crisis are prioritized in emergency relief and long-term recovery policy solutions. 

Underserved communities, including communities of color, are disproportionately exposed to air pollution that increases cardiovascular and respiratory illnesses. These are two of the underlying health conditions that put people into a higher risk category if they come into contact with SARS-CoV-2, the virus that causes COVID-19. These at-risk communities are the focus of advocacy efforts by ECOS and Green For All for immediate and long-term economic relief.

To support Green For All’s advocacy programs, ECOS is donating $1 for every 100-ounce or larger ECOS Hypoallergenic Laundry Detergent it sells during the month of April 2020, up to $100,000 every year for two years.

ABOUT ECOS®

Family owned and operated since 1967, ECOS makes plant-powered laundry detergents and cleaners that are safer for people, pets and the planet. ECOS is a leader in sustainable manufacturing with the world’s first carbon neutral, water neutral and TRUE Platinum Zero Waste-certified facilities in the U.S.  ECOS cleaners are thoughtfully sourced, made without formaldehyde or dyes, pH balanced, readily biodegradable formula and never tested on animals. The company has received many awards for its innovations in safer green chemistry, including the U.S. EPA’s coveted Safer Choice Partner of the Year award. ECOS, Baby ECOS, ECOS Pets and ECOS PRO cleaners are available at major club and grocery retailers and natural foods stores throughout the U.S., internationally and online. ABOUT GREEN FOR ALL

Green For All is a national program of The Dream Corps, founded by Van Jones in 2008 to build an inclusive green economy strong enough to lift people out of poverty. Green For All ensures that as we transition to a clean energy economy, communities hit first and worst by pollution are not last and least to benefit from the solutions.
